Umrah is a sacred pilgrimage to the city of Makkah in Saudia Arabia. Muslims from all around the world visit Makkah in order to perform Umrah as an act of worship. Umrah, unlike Hajj is a non-obligatory act of worship that the Muslims can perform throughout the year.

How to perfrom Umrah?
Performing Umrah is not a very difficult task however; it requires your pure intention which is supposed to be specifically for Allah. Almighty.
Below are the steps that are followed in sequence to perform Umrah:
Ihram:
It is the intention or the Niyyah that you make for Umrah. Miqat is a boundary from where it is obligatory for you enter the state of Ihram. Ihram is a state when men wear two white pieces of unstitched clothing and there is no specific garment for women.
In short, it is a state of purity and devotion and you put aside your worldly distractions and focus on your connection with Allah (SWT).
In possible, you can pray two rakahs nafil on entering the state of Ihram.
Moreover, you must recite Talbiyah repeatedly during the journey.
Tawaf:
When discussing Umrah rituals guide, the next most important ritual is the Tawaf.
Tawaf is encircling Holy Kabah seven times anticlockwise starting from the Black stone. Men should walk fast in the first 3 rounds.
After Tawaf, it is recommended to pray two rakahs at Maqam e Ibrahim.
Sai:
The next important ritual is Sai. It is an act of worship that is reaancted Hajar’s (Prophet Ibrahim’s wife) search of water for her son, Ismail. So, after Tawaf you have to go to Mount Safa and while facing the Kaabah, you must make dua. After that, you walk between the Mounts Safa and Marwah seven times, starting from Safa. Sai procedure is not very difficult as it starts from Mount Safa and ends at Mount Marwah. Your walk between Safa to Marwah will be counted as one and from Marwah to Safa as two and in the same way you will continue until you complete seven walks.
Tahallul:
After Sai, it is obligatory that men shave their heads and women trim a short portion of their hair. This act marks the end of Umrah and you exit Ihram. Exiting Ihram is known as Tahallul. Therefore, Tahallul meaning in Arabic is coming out of the state of Ihram.
What are the Ihram rules?
When the pilgrim enters the state of Ihram, he must follow a few rules, which are as follows:
Rules for clothing
Men:
- Must wear two unstitched white piece of clothing
- No stitched clothing should be on the body like socks
- Men are not allowed to cover their heads
Women:
- Women must wear modest clothing, there are no hard and fast rules for this.
- The face and hands must be uncovered
- Women are allowed to wear socks during Ihram
- Prohibited acts during Ihram:
- In the state of Ihram, you are not allowed to do the following:
- Trimming nails or cutting hair
- Using any scented product or perfume
- Sexaul activities
- Hunting and killing of animals
- Fighting ans using nad language
- Covering face for women and covering head is not allowed for men.
Therefore, it is important to follow the Ihram rules and in case of violation of any of the Ihram rules it results in penalty known as the “kaffarah” in Arabic.
The penalty is determined according to the violation of the Ihram rules by Islamic scholars in the light of Quranic teachings and Hadith.
What are the Tawaf steps?
Tawaf is encircling Holy Kabah seven times anticlockwise. Below are the steps:
- Facing Hajare Aswad and saying Bismillah Allahu Akbar.
- Walking anticlockwise starting from the Black stone. Keep in mind that during Tawaf, Kabah will be on your left side.
- Say duas, dikhr during Tawaf and avoid worldly discussions.
- Your one round will be completed from where you have started, that is the Black stone. You can start your second round by saying the Takbeer again.
- After the completion of the 7 rounds, it is optional to pray 2 rakahs near Maqame Ibrahim.
- Drink Zamzam and make dua.
